Introduction

Myeongdong Hongdukkae Handmade Kalguksu is a local favorite located in Machen-dong, Songpa-gu, Seoul, known for its chewy noodles that are kneaded and cut by hand. This kalguksu specialty restaurant is famous for its reasonable prices and generous portions, especially its rich anchovy broth and homemade fresh kimchi, which are very popular.

It is a casual Korean restaurant where anyone can visit without burden, making it a great place for family and friends to dine comfortably. A variety of seasonal menus are also available, allowing you to enjoy different flavors of kalguksu.

Main Features

The handmade kalguksu noodles, kneaded and cut with a kitchen knife, have a pleasantly chewy texture, and the mussel kalguksu is packed with mussels, offering a refreshing broth. A variety of dumpling dishes are also available, making for excellent combinations.

The prices are very reasonable, making it ideal for customers seeking great value meals. The kimchi is homemade fresh napa cabbage kimchi, available at a self-service corner, and takeout service is also provided for convenient enjoyment at home.

Parking Information

There is no dedicated parking nearby, so public transportation is recommended. It is about a 5-minute walk from Machen Station and Geoyeo Station on Subway Line 5, making it easily accessible. If you drive, you will need to find parking in nearby alleys or around Machen Market, so parking may be somewhat inconvenient.
